What to Expect from This Private Boat Tour

This experience is all about customization and comfort. Unlike group tours with fixed routes, here you’ll meet your captain ahead of time—probably via WhatsApp or direct communication—and discuss what you want to see. Whether that’s cruising past scenic spots, stopping for swimming in quiet coves, or checking out specific islands, your captain will help craft your perfect day.

The boat itself is private, meaning only your group will be onboard. It’s equipped with all safety gear, bottled water, snorkeling equipment, and wind jackets—small details that make a day on the water more enjoyable, especially if the weather turns or you want to stay comfortable while exploring.

Your tour typically begins around 9:00 am, giving you a full day for discovery. The review mentions that the boat ride is smooth and the captain is professional, which is key when you’re out on open water for hours.

Practicalities and Costs

Private Captain Tailored tour - from Split and Trogir - Practicalities and Costs

At $534.67 for up to seven people, the cost might seem high compared to shared tours. But remember, this price includes the private boat, the skipper, snorkeling gear, safety equipment, and wind jackets. You also get a full fuel tank, which is refilled at the end of the trip—so no hidden fuel costs.

The main variable is fuel costs—dependent on how far and long you cruise. This is clearly communicated, and the skipper handles refilling at the gas station after the tour.

Booking on average 116 days in advance suggests high demand, and it’s worth planning ahead. The tour is available from 9:00 am, giving you a full nine hours of exploration.

FAQ

Private Captain Tailored tour - from Split and Trogir - FAQ

Is this tour suitable for small groups or couples?
Yes, it’s designed for groups up to 7 people, making it ideal for families, friends, or couples wanting a private experience.

What is included in the price?
The tour includes a private boat, professional skipper, bottled water, snorkeling gear, full safety equipment, and wind jackets. Fuel is not included but is handled at the end of the day.

What if the weather turns bad?
The experience is weather-dependent. If canceled due to poor conditions,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.

Can I customize my itinerary?
Absolutely. The tour is entirely flexible—your skipper will help craft your personalized route based on your preferences.

How long does the tour last?
Approximately 9 hours, starting at 9:00 am, giving plenty of time for multiple stops, swimming, or simply relaxing.

Do I need to book far in advance?
Yes, most travelers book around 116 days ahead, which suggests this is popular and best secured early.

Are there any extra costs I should be aware of?
Fuel costs are not included in the price; you’ll refill the tank at the end of the trip. Personal expenses are also not included.
